Yala durian registered as GI product

Designation expected to give a boost to sales and exports of unique fruit

Durian sadet nam Yala, indigenous to the southern border province, can sell for as much as 190 baht a kilogramme. (Photo: Intellectual Property Department)

A type of durian unique to the southern border province of Yala has been given official geographical indication (GI) designation, which should help sales and increase growers’ income, according to Deputy Commerce Minister Sinit Lertkrai.

The Intellectual Property Department announced the registration of “durian sadet nam Yala” on Wednesday. With its unique taste and smell, the fruit sells for as much as 190 baht per kilogramme. It generates as much as 2.8 billion baht a…
